DANA LEE BROWN is a textile-focused clothing line, built on a range of custom field-to-loom fabrics developed together with North American farms and supply chains.
The design starts with natural fibres grown as close to home as possible—followed by yarn spinning, weaving, knitting, and other steps that extend from the Cascadian Coastline to the Maritimes.
While textiles are typically reliant on a complex network of global supply chains, the creative challenge of exploring what can be made with resources close at hand is what continues to shape the work. The intention is not only to invest in restorative local fibre systems, but to create textiles that are both unique and compelling—reflective of the landscapes they come from.

DANA
Formerly of DANA LEE (2008–2016), Dana grew up in Northern BC and Vancouver before moving to New York to design menswear. There, she eventually founded her eponymous label, before taking a five-year hiatus from the garment industry.
Her prior experience with North American garment and textile production serves as the foundation for this deeper exploration into place, while carrying forward her long-standing interest in garments shaped by both humility and expression.
Since 2018, Dana has resided on NEXWLÉLEXWM (Bowen Island), the ancestral and unceded territory of the SḴWX̱WÚ7MESH ÚXWUMIXW (Squamish Nation), where her brand is also based.
